“Yes — there are two NFL teams whose names don’t end with an ‘s,'” ChatGPT says, before proceeding to list two teams that do.
“The only two teams that don’t end with ‘s’ are: Miami Dolphins ❌ no (wait, ends with s),” it says, catching its mistake.
Or “let me do this systematically.”“The actual correct answer is,” ChatGPT says at one point, not realizing the shtick is getting old.
Other users posted examples where ChatGPT eventually gives the correct answer, but only after stringing the user along a similarly delirious spiel.
